roop-unleashed终极教程:无需训练的AI换脸神器,5分钟制作专业级深度伪造
2026/6/25 17:16:07 网站建设 项目流程

roop-unleashed终极教程:无需训练的AI换脸神器,5分钟制作专业级深度伪造

【免费下载链接】roop-unleashedEvolved Fork of roop with Web Server and lots of additions项目地址: https://gitcode.com/gh_mirrors/ro/roop-unleashed

想要制作电影级别的换脸特效却担心技术门槛太高?roop-unleashed正是你需要的解决方案!这款革命性的AI换脸工具让深度伪造技术变得简单易用,无论你是内容创作者、视频爱好者还是技术新手,都能在几分钟内完成专业级的人脸交换效果。无需复杂的深度学习训练,无需昂贵的硬件设备,只需一个浏览器就能开始你的创意之旅。

🎯 roop-unleashed核心价值:为什么这款AI换脸工具与众不同

传统的AI换脸工具通常需要数小时的模型训练和复杂的命令行操作,而roop-unleashed彻底改变了这一局面。基于预训练模型和直观的Web界面,它让深度伪造技术真正实现了"开箱即用"。

三大核心优势解析

零门槛操作体验

  • 免训练即用:下载后直接使用,省去数小时甚至数天的模型训练时间
  • 浏览器界面:无需编程知识,所有操作都在Web界面中完成
  • 全平台兼容:Windows、Linux、macOS系统全面支持

专业级处理能力

  • 智能人脸检测:自动识别图像中的多个人脸并进行精准匹配
  • 实时预览功能:处理结果即时显示,方便调整参数
  • 批量处理支持:一次性处理多个图像或视频文件
  • 多种输出格式:支持PNG、JPEG、MP4等多种格式

模块化技术架构

  • 丰富的处理器模块:在roop/processors/目录下,包含CodeFormer、GFPGAN等多种专业处理模块
  • 灵活的配置系统:通过配置文件轻松调整系统参数
  • 持续更新维护:活跃的开发者社区定期发布新功能

🚀 快速启动指南:从零开始制作第一个换脸作品

环境准备与安装步骤

Windows用户快速启动

git clone https://gitcode.com/gh_mirrors/ro/roop-unleashed cd roop-unleashed installer/windows_run.bat

Linux用户一键安装

git clone https://gitcode.com/gh_mirrors/ro/roop-unleashed cd roop-unleashed python run.py

macOS用户简易部署

git clone https://gitcode.com/gh_mirrors/ro/roop-unleashed cd roop-unleashed sh runMacOS.sh

首次运行注意事项

  • 首次启动会自动下载约2GB的预训练模型
  • 确保网络连接稳定,下载时间约10-30分钟
  • 建议预留至少10GB的可用存储空间
  • 系统将自动检测并配置GPU加速(如可用)

界面功能全面解析

启动后,你会看到一个专业而直观的操作界面,采用深色主题设计,功能分区清晰:

左侧面板:素材管理区

  • 源人脸选择:上传待交换的人脸图片
  • 目标文件区:添加需要处理的图片或视频
  • 批量操作功能:支持多文件同时添加和管理

中部控制区:参数调节中心

  • 人脸相似度阈值:控制匹配精度(0-0.65范围)
  • 处理模式选择:内存处理或文件流处理
  • 无人脸处理策略:设置无人脸时的应对方式

右侧预览区:实时效果展示

  • 原始图像预览:显示目标文件的原始内容
  • 处理结果预览:实时展示换脸效果
  • 视频帧控制:精确控制处理的起始和结束帧

底部功能区:输出与增强

  • 增强器选项:CodeFormer、GFPGAN等专业增强工具
  • 文本遮罩功能:通过文本描述保护特定区域
  • 最终输出管理:处理完成的文件预览和保存

🎨 实战操作全流程:从基础应用到高级技巧

第一阶段:静态图片换脸快速上手

准备工作要点

  1. 素材选择标准

    • 源人脸图片:正面清晰,光线均匀,分辨率建议800×600以上
    • 目标图片:分辨率建议1080p以上,面部角度与源图片相似
  2. 参数设置黄金法则

    • 人脸相似度阈值:从0.65开始,根据效果微调
    • 增强器选择:CodeFormer混合比例设为0.5
    • 处理模式:选择"首选检测模式"进行快速处理
  3. 执行与优化流程

    • 点击橙色"Start"按钮开始处理
    • 观察预览效果,微调参数
    • 保存高质量输出结果

不同场景参数参考表| 应用场景 | 相似度阈值 | 增强器设置 | 处理时间 | 适用场景 | |---------|-----------|-----------|---------|---------| | 快速预览 | 0.55-0.60 | 关闭 | 1-2秒 | 测试效果 | | 标准质量 | 0.65-0.70 | CodeFormer 0.5 | 3-5秒 | 日常使用 | | 高质量输出 | 0.75-0.80 | CodeFormer 0.7 + GFPGAN | 5-10秒 | 专业作品 | | 复杂场景 | 0.60-0.65 | 多种增强器组合 | 10-15秒 | 多光源环境 |

第二阶段:视频换脸专业处理

视频处理最佳实践

预处理检查清单

  • ✅ 视频格式:MP4、AVI、MOV等常见格式
  • ✅ 分辨率优化:不超过1080p以获得最佳性能
  • ✅ 帧率保持:使用原视频帧率
  • ✅ 音频处理:根据需求选择是否保留原音频

批量处理策略

  1. 分段处理长视频

    • 使用Set as Start/Set as End功能
    • 每次处理5-10分钟片段
    • 使用"File streaming"模式减少内存占用
  2. 质量与速度平衡

    • 预览阶段:降低分辨率,关闭增强器
    • 最终输出:启用所有后处理选项
    • 批量作业:夜间处理,充分利用系统资源
  3. 实时处理优化

    • 切换到Live Cam模式
    • 调整处理延迟平衡实时性和质量
    • 设置虚拟摄像头输出

第三阶段:高级功能深度应用

处理器模块详解

roop-unleashed的强大之处在于其模块化的处理器架构,每个模块都有特定功能:

人脸增强处理器

  • Enhance_CodeFormer.py:基于CodeFormer的人脸修复技术
  • Enhance_GFPGAN.py:使用GFPGAN进行面部增强
  • Enhance_RestoreFormerPPlus.py:高级修复技术

遮罩处理器

  • Mask_Clip2Seg.py:文本驱动智能遮罩
  • Mask_XSeg.py:XSeg高级面部遮罩技术

帧处理处理器

  • Frame_Colorizer.py:黑白视频上色功能
  • Frame_Upscale.py:视频超分辨率处理

⚡ 性能优化与问题解决指南

硬件配置建议

不同预算配置方案

配置等级CPU推荐内存需求显卡建议存储空间适用场景
入门级Intel i5 / AMD R58GB集成显卡256GB SSD图片处理、短视频
主流级Intel i7 / AMD R716GBGTX 1660512GB SSD1080p视频处理
专业级Intel i9 / AMD R932GBRTX 30601TB NVMe4K视频、实时处理
工作站级线程撕裂者64GB+RTX 40902TB NVMe批量生产、专业制作

常见问题解决方案

问题1:模型下载失败

解决方案: 1. 检查网络连接状态 2. 尝试使用网络代理 3. 手动下载模型文件到models/目录 4. 验证存储空间是否充足

问题2:GPU加速无法启用

排查步骤: 1. 更新显卡驱动到最新版本 2. 确认CUDA工具包正确安装 3. 检查settings.py中的GPU配置 4. 验证显卡是否支持CUDA

问题3:处理效果不自然

优化技巧: 1. 调整相似度阈值到0.65-0.75范围 2. 尝试不同的增强器组合 3. 使用文本遮罩保护重要特征 4. 检查源图片和目标图片的光线匹配

问题4:内存不足导致崩溃

应对策略: 1. 降低处理分辨率 2. 使用文件流处理模式 3. 分段处理大型视频文件 4. 关闭不必要的后台程序

高级优化技巧

处理器模块深度应用

人脸相似度阈值设置指南

  • 宽松匹配(0.3-0.5):适合面部角度差异大的场景
  • 平衡匹配(0.6-0.7):大多数情况的最佳选择
  • 严格匹配(0.8-0.9):确保面部特征高度一致

增强器使用技巧

  1. CodeFormer:最适合修复模糊或低质量人脸
  2. GFPGAN:在保持细节的同时增强面部
  3. 混合使用:尝试不同增强器的组合效果

🔧 实用技巧与工作流程优化

参数调优黄金法则

工作流程优化建议

高效批量处理流程

  1. 素材预处理阶段

    • 统一所有文件的分辨率和格式
    • 创建清晰的文件夹结构
    • 备份原始文件
  2. 参数测试阶段

    • 使用小样片测试不同参数组合
    • 记录最佳参数设置
    • 创建参数配置文件
  3. 批量执行阶段

    • 使用脚本自动化处理
    • 监控系统资源使用情况
    • 定期保存处理进度

质量检查清单

处理前检查项目

  • 源人脸图片清晰度高
  • 目标文件格式兼容
  • 系统资源充足
  • 参数设置合理
  • 存储空间足够

处理后验证标准

  • 面部特征自然过渡
  • 边缘处理平滑
  • 颜色匹配准确
  • 整体效果协调
  • 文件保存完整

⚖️ 伦理使用与法律合规指南

技术应用的责任边界

roop-unleashed作为强大的AI工具,必须负责任地使用:

允许的应用场景

  • ✅ 学术研究和教育演示
  • ✅ 个人娱乐和创意表达
  • ✅ 影视特效和艺术创作
  • ✅ 技术验证和原型开发
  • ✅ 历史影像修复

严格禁止的应用场景

  • ❌ 未经授权的肖像使用
  • ❌ 虚假信息传播
  • ❌ 身份欺诈和诈骗行为
  • ❌ 侵犯他人隐私和名誉
  • ❌ 政治恶意使用

伦理使用最佳实践

知情同意原则

  1. 明确告知:使用他人肖像前必须获得明确授权
  2. 内容标注:在线发布AI生成内容时必须明确标注
  3. 尊重隐私:不处理未成年人、公众人物敏感内容
  4. 技术透明:向观众说明使用的技术和工具

法律合规建议

  • 遵守当地肖像权相关法律法规
  • 确保使用的素材不侵犯他人版权
  • 了解各社交媒体平台的AI内容政策
  • 项目开发者不承担用户不当使用造成的法律责任

🚀 进阶探索与社区参与

技术深度探索

配置文件深度调优

通过settings.py文件,你可以深入了解所有可配置的系统参数:

性能优化配置

# 线程与内存配置 self.max_threads = 2 # 最大线程数 self.memory_limit = 0 # 内存限制(0表示无限制) # 计算后端选择 self.provider = 'cuda' # 可选:cuda、cpu、directml # 输出格式设置 self.output_image_format = 'png' # 输出图片格式 self.output_video_format = 'mp4' # 输出视频格式

UI组件定制化

通过ui/tabs/目录下的各个标签页文件,你可以深入了解界面组件的实现:

  • faceswap_tab.py:核心换脸功能界面
  • livecam_tab.py:实时摄像头处理界面
  • facemgr_tab.py:人脸库管理界面
  • extras_tab.py:额外工具和功能
  • settings_tab.py:系统设置界面

社区参与方式

作为开源项目,roop-unleashed欢迎社区成员的参与和贡献:

贡献代码的途径

  1. 问题修复:帮助解决已知的技术问题
  2. 功能开发:添加新功能或优化现有功能
  3. 代码优化:改进代码结构和性能
  4. 测试完善:编写测试用例确保代码质量

文档改进方向

  • 完善使用指南和教程
  • 翻译多语言文档
  • 制作视频教程和案例分享
  • 编写技术博客和经验分享

社区互动方式

  • 提交Bug报告和功能建议
  • 参与技术讨论和问题解答
  • 分享使用经验和创意作品
  • 帮助新用户快速上手

学习资源推荐

入门学习路径

  1. 基础掌握:阅读项目README文档,了解基本功能
  2. 实践操作:跟随本文指南完成第一个换脸项目
  3. 参数探索:尝试不同参数组合,理解各项功能

进阶研究方向

  1. 源码分析:深入研究各个处理器模块的实现
  2. 技术扩展:探索AI换脸技术的最新发展
  3. 应用创新:开发新的使用场景和应用模式

实践项目建议

  • 小型创意视频制作
  • 技术演示和教学材料
  • 开源贡献和代码优化
  • 社区教程和案例分享

💎 总结:开启你的AI创意之旅

roop-unleashed不仅仅是一个工具,更是一个创意平台。它将复杂的AI技术转化为简单易用的操作界面,让每个人都能成为深度伪造的创作者。

核心价值总结

  1. 技术民主化:让专业级AI技术触手可及
  2. 操作简易化:Web界面降低使用门槛
  3. 功能全面化:支持图片、视频、实时处理
  4. 架构模块化:易于扩展和定制
  5. 社区开放化:开源共享,共同进步

给新用户的实用建议

  • 从简单的图片处理开始,逐步挑战复杂项目
  • 多尝试不同的参数组合,找到最适合的风格
  • 关注项目更新,及时获取新功能
  • 加入社区,与全球用户交流经验

未来展望随着AI技术的不断发展,roop-unleashed也将持续进化。我们期待看到更多创意应用的出现,也欢迎更多开发者和用户的加入,共同推动这项技术向着更安全、更智能、更有创意的方向发展。

记住,技术是中性的,关键在于使用者的意图。希望你能用roop-unleashed创造出有价值、有创意、有温度的内容,让AI技术真正为人类的创造力服务。

现在,就打开你的浏览器,开始探索AI换脸的无限可能吧!🎬✨

【免费下载链接】roop-unleashedEvolved Fork of roop with Web Server and lots of additions项目地址: https://gitcode.com/gh_mirrors/ro/roop-unleashed

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询